Creates a subnet CIDR reservation¶
Description¶
Creates a subnet CIDR reservation. For more information, see Subnet CIDR reservations in the Amazon VPC User Guide and Manage prefixes for your network interfaces in the Amazon EC2 User Guide.
Usage¶
ec2_create_subnet_cidr_reservation(SubnetId, Cidr, ReservationType,
Description, DryRun, TagSpecifications)
Arguments¶
SubnetId |
[required] The ID of the subnet. |
Cidr |
[required] The IPv4 or IPV6 CIDR range to reserve. |
ReservationType |
[required] The type of reservation. The reservation type determines how the reserved IP addresses are assigned to resources.
|
Description |
The description to assign to the subnet CIDR reservation. |
DryRun |

TagSpecifications |
The tags to assign to the subnet CIDR reservation. |
Value¶
A list with the following syntax:
list(
SubnetCidrReservation = list(
SubnetCidrReservationId = "string",
SubnetId = "string",
Cidr = "string",
ReservationType = "prefix"|"explicit",
OwnerId = "string",
Description = "string",
Tags = list(
list(
Key = "string",
Value = "string"
)
)
)
)
Request syntax¶
svc$create_subnet_cidr_reservation(
SubnetId = "string",
Cidr = "string",
ReservationType = "prefix"|"explicit",
Description = "string",
DryRun = TRUE|FALSE,
